Transaction 42294233c596d46e073e1dbf8a209f8d22cc8d38de93a289eae827ff67fc20e6
1 Input
1 Output
-
42294233c596d46e073e1dbf8a209f8d22cc8d38de93a289eae827ff67fc20e6:0
- value
- 16472515
- script pubkey
- OP_0 OP_PUSHBYTES_20 945b9c0aab910f6d2cdb6e55bc82e0f3b73267b0
- address
- bc1qj3decz4tjy8k6txmde2meqhq7wmnyeas7sfrnl